Resilience Poem by Cynthia Buhain-baello

These trying times demand it
No halcyon days ahead.
But all hard work brings profit
Stand up and refuse to dread!

As the diamond remains a stone
Without the drill and the cutting,
Pleasures based on wealth alone
Robs man the chance of persevering.

True measure of success in life
Is hinged on Wisdom and on Prudence
Courage, patience through the strife,
Facing hardships with Resilience.

For out of Adversity's crucible
Come strength of character and will
And a man discovers he is able
To reach his goals, his dreams fulfill.



--
(July 2,2008 Tarlac City Philippines)

This was published in 'The Anguillan' issue March 25,2011.
